A shocking discovery shattered the peaceful atmosphere of Key Largo’s Amore Dive Resort. A woman’s body was found at the high-end resort, leading to the arrest of a local man. The victim was identified as 43-year-old Nadine Marie Tillman by the Monroe County Sheriff’s Office. The grim discovery prompted an immediate investigation, resulting in the arrest of a suspect.
The body of Tillman was discovered in one of the resort’s rooms on Monday. By Tuesday, 33-year-old Dylan Lamb, a local resident, was arrested and charged with murder. It is believed that Tillman and Lamb had met at the resort the previous Saturday.
The investigation was launched after Tillman’s daughter reported her mother missing, having been unable to reach her. This led law enforcement to the resort, where they found Tillman’s car and subsequently, her body. The circumstances of her death have left the community reeling.
Authorities revealed that Tillman had been brutally beaten. A red SUV, spotted at the crime scene, was later cordoned off with crime scene tape. Its role in the crime, however, remains unclear. Witnesses reported seeing a man in the area around the time of the incident.
Lamb, the suspect, has a history of legal troubles, including charges of grand theft and battery. His arrest on a murder charge has sent shockwaves through the usually tranquil resort community, as residents and visitors struggle to come to terms with the disturbing event.
